MPs demand severe limits on Taser use and ask for an inquiry by the Home Affairs Select Committee3.28.34pm GMT Wed 17th Dec 2008 Following the news report released today by Amnesty International which revealed that 90% of those who died after being stunned with a Taser were unarmed, Tom Brake MP, Home Affairs Spokesman for the Liberal Democrats and member of the Home Affairs Select Committee is asking for a Home Affairs Select Committee inquiry into the use of Tasers. An EDM published in Parliament today by Tom Brake MP urges the Government to limit the use of Taser guns. Tom said, "Amnesty's report throws serious doubts on the Home Office's claim that Tasers are a non-lethal weapon. "It is vital that we have an in-depth inquiry from the Select Committee into the use of Tasers before they are commonplace on British streets. "There are already serious concerns that giving more officers use of Tasers is taking us on the slippery slope to fully-armed, US-style policing." Last month, Jacqui Smith extended the use of Tasers to 10,000 police officers all across the UK after trial in 10 police forces.
